Fuel injector oscilloscope pattern
Tumblr media
FUEL INJECTOR OSCILLOSCOPE PATTERN DRIVER
If all fuel injectors and system circuits are correct, a controller failure or programming error has probably occurred. Use a multimeter to determine if the wires are in good working order, and correct any problems to correct error P062D. If no abnormalities are found in the fuel injectors, disconnect the circuit from the PCM and the fuel injector. If necessary, replace the defective fuel injectors. With the oscilloscope wires connected, note any inconsistencies in the wave pattern. If the system wiring and connectors are serviceable, use an oscilloscope to check each individual fuel injector. This increases the chance that the sensor connectors, as well as other electrical connections, will become corroded. Sometimes water or fluids can stagnate in the nozzle seating areas. Also look for melted or otherwise damaged areas. Look carefully for abrasions, bare wires, or breaks. Visually inspect all wiring and connectors leading to the fuel injectors (Bank 1). If the problem is described, following the instructions may save you time and money in diagnosing and correcting the problem. It’s a good idea to first look up the Technical Service Bulletins (TSB) for your specific make of car with error P062D. If no problems are found, check and replace the PCM or EFI control module if necessary.Measure voltage in injectors supply circuit, replace failed injectors if necessary.Check the operation of the fuel injectors (Bank 1).
FUEL INJECTOR OSCILLOSCOPE PATTERN DRIVER
If the code appears, visually inspect the electrical wires and connectors related to the injector driver circuit.Clear the error codes and test drive the vehicle to see if code P062D appears again.Read all stored data and error codes with an OBD-II scan tool.Some suggested steps for troubleshooting and fix the error code P062D: Sometimes the cause is a defective module (PCM).Faulty electronic fuel injection (EFI) controller.Bad electrical connection in the circuit connector.Breakage or short circuit of electric wires in the injector driver circuit.Failure of one or more fuel injectors (Bank 1).The error code P062D can mean that one or more of the following problems have occurred: It is recommended to correct it as soon as possible to avoid serious damage to the engine or other components. Possible ignition skips in the engine cylinders.įault P062D is a serious error, as it may cause engine and driving problems.Floating revolutions, as well as attempts to stall at idle.Check engine control lamp on the control panel will light up (the code will be recorded in the memory as a malfunction).The main signal that an error P062D has occurred is the Malfunction Indicator Lamp (MIL) is also known as the CheckEngine Light. The Malfunction Indicator Light (MIL) will also illuminate. If the PCM detects a fuel injector confirmation signal that is not as expected, code P062D will be stored. This allows the PCM to detect a problem before it affects drivability. In addition to controlling the fuel injection system, the PCM also monitors the feedback resistance in the fuel injector circuit for signs of failure. Since DC battery voltage is already present in the circuit, this initiates precise atomization of fuel from the pressurized fuel injector. The PCM controls the injector’s throttle timing and pulse width by applying a ground pulse to the circuit at the right moment. The fuel injector driver is part of the PCM or electronic fuel injection (EFI) controller. Fuel injectors were introduced as a replacement for the carburetor because they are more efficient and effective in controlling the fuel supply. Bank 1 indicates the engine side containing cylinder number one.įuel systems use a variety of components to control and monitor volume, timing, pressure, etc. Stored code P062D means that the Powertrain Control Module (PCM) has detected a problem with the operation of the fuel injector driver circuit. Technical description and explained code P062D This fault designation applies to all vehicles equipped with OBD-II. Fault code P062D is called “Fuel Injector Driver Circuit Performance (Bank 1)” but in different programs it may be called differently.

Large LED display with 4 Pulse Modes, the continuous mode (mode 4) helps identify good or bad injector. Test Lead 41.5cm / 16.3 inches The tester can help diagnose injector problems,you can use it to test each injector individually to help idently stuck,leaking or burnt-out conditions Works with engine off and pulse timer may be used with fuel pressure gauge The mode lock feature ensures test condition uniformity. EM276 Injector Tester can works with any fuel pressure tester. Please NOTE: Gasoline car only, NOT the diesel engine Unbox and reviews KOLSOL EM276 Automotive Injector Tester 4 Pluse Modes Powerful Fuel System Scan Tool Fuel Injector Tester EM276 Injector Tester Specification: Power Supply:12V vehicle battery Operation Environment:0-40°C,relative humidityStorage Environment:-10°C ~50°C, relative humidityTest Cable Length: 41.5cm/ 16.3 inches Product Size:147x82x29mm Operation Instruction: 1.Turn off the vehicle's engine. 2. Connect the black clip to the negative terminal of the vehicle battery, connect the red clip to the positive terminal of the battery. 3.Locate the fuel injector which you want to test, then remove the electrical cable from this injector and connect the tester's two pulse output terminals to the electrical connector of this injector. 4.Press the MODE SET key to select the desired pulse mode, the display shows the current pulse mode. Explanations for the 4 Modes: Mode1: the tester will output 1 pulse, whose pulse width is about 250ms. Mode 2: the tester will output 50 pulses, every pulse's pulse width is about 7ms. Mode 3: the tester will output 100 pulses, every pulse's pulse width is about 3.5ms. Mode 4: the tester will output continuously at the rate of 50 pulses per about 1450ms, every pulse's pulse width is about 7ms. At any time, you can press the PULSE key again to stop outputting pluse. 5. After you have selected the desired pulse mode, press the PULSE key. The tester outputs pulse(s) to the injector under test, the pulse signal indicator will light as indication. Update on repairing 1995 Ferrari F355 with fuel injector, and now ignition coil issues. via /r/cars
Update on repairing 1995 Ferrari F355 with fuel injector, and now ignition coil issues.
After spending all day and night researching this thing, I discovered I was at first completely wrong on how the engine operates. There are two engine computers and each one operates independently of one another. I should have figured because there are two engine malfunction lights on the dash like in the Lamborghini Countach and Diablo. Each engine control module controls a bank of 4 cylinders. They are both the Bosch Motronic 2.7
I was having issues with the left bank of cylinders. The fuel injectors and spark plugs drop out and will fire randomly, even with the key on but the engine not running. Chryslers will usually have this issue when the camshaft or crankshaft position sensor fails, so I assumed there is a bad senaor somewhere.
The two crankshaft position sensors are on the front of the engine and I still haven't really found the camshaft position sensors, so I hook up my oscilloscope directly to the engine control module to do testing.
I hook up my scope with one channel on the ground side of injector 8. The other three channels are connected to the cam and crank sensor signal inputs on the ECM. As soon as I turn the key on, I see activity on the injectors and ignition coil, but the cam and crank show no activity. Things aren't looking good for the ECM.
I remove the ECM entirely and hook it up on the workbench. There is nothing connected to it other than powers and grounds, but when I scope the injector and coil control, they're going crazy. That's it, I'm done. Bad ECM.
I really feel silly for having so much problems with this car. Just because it's on old Ferrari doesn't mean it's complicated or anything. Just a little different from the new cars I'm used to working on. I'm glad it wasn't a sensor issue because I believe the engine needs removed to reach the crank sensors.

 THE BASICS BEHIND HARD STARTING AND DRIVABILITY DIAGNOSTIC SERVICES AT FX MOBILE MECHANIC SERVICES OMAHA
 We offer three levels of drivability/performance tests to track down even the most elusive performance problems.
  LEVEL 1:
 Visually inspect:
 ·         Battery cables and connections
·         Spark plug wires and secondary ignition components
·         Vacuum hoses and routing
·         Air inlet ducting
·         Wiring to sensors and actuators
 Road test vehicle to verify symptoms
 ·         Check coolant level & engine operating temperature
·         Check system charging voltage and electrical system noise
·         Check idle speed
·         Check base ignition timing, dwell, and operation of timing advance controls
·         Check engine vacuum: cranking, idle & 2500 rpm
·         Analyze primary & secondary ignition signals on oscilloscope
·         Perform cylinder power balance test
·         Check fuel pressure
·         Check tail pipe emissions readings
·         Check for vacuum leaks
·         Pull and record Diagnostic Trouble Codes (DTCs)
·         Check for related technical service bulletins or IdentaFix® bulletins
·         Analyze data and recommend necessary repairs
  LEVEL 2
 ·         Perform additional, symptom specific diagnostics
·         Diagnose relevant DTCs
·         Lab scope analysis of sensors and actuators
·         Additional road testing as needed for dynamic tests of engine control systems and intermittent problems
·         Access diagnostic hot line and on-line sources
·         If cold start or warm up problem exists, vehicle will be needed for a minimum of two days.
·         Tests of warm engine parameters will be checked the first day and specific cold running systems will be checked the following day.
 LEVEL 3
 ·         Level 3 diagnostics are geared toward problems that are very intermittent and require extensive time to duplicate. Due to the nature of Level 3 diagnostics, appropriate tests are selected based on the nature of the symptoms and the results of earlier diagnostic tests.
 ·         Level 3 includes time for set up and road testing of vehicle with specialized equipment as needed and also includes time for an additional technician's time to monitor equipment during road tests for safe operation of the vehicle.
 Diesel engines contain many components and small systems. Problems with systems and components can lead to hard starting and the need for drivability diagnostic. When your diesel engine is hard to start, there are several things worth checking. First is the temperature. Diesel engines rely upon heat for the combustion process to occur. If the engine uses glow plugs, they may need to warm up before they can properly start the engine. Second is oil. The internal components of a diesel engine require a lubricant to perform at their best. Engine oil can prevent harmful friction from occurring and can remove dirt and other damaging debris. If a vehicle has a turbocharger, a dirty or low amount of lubrication may also harm the turbocharger and lead to drivability and hard starting issues. A bad battery, fuel supply, and fuel injectors may also lead to hard starting issues.

2003 Ford Explorer 4.0 SOHC XLT- Cranks but does not start (fixed) (Occam’s Razor)
Known facts
IAC is operational
DPFE is operational
Tumblr media
TPS is operational
Tumblr media
Crank Sensor is operational
Fuel pump is operational @60-65 PSI
Injector drivers/ pulse width
Tumblr media
Inertial switch circuit for fuel pump
Relays (All good)
Ignition coil
Tumblr media
Various codes
B1352—- code for door chime circuit? Not cause of no start (Power loss related)
U1027—– Power loss related
B1483—– Brake pedal input circuit failure? (Ghost code power loss related)
P2197- O2 Sensor Signal Biased/Stuck Lean (Bank 2 Sensor 1) Code= Evidence of?
P0200 was pending- may have short in injector harness ( Ghost code power related).
Check with noid light, oscilloscope or probe (power-probe 4) ( All work fine and within specification)
C1284- normal code if engine is off when scanned.
Recheck the crankshaft position harness wiring and plug Good
check camshaft position sensor Good
recheck mass airflow sensor and intake air temp sensor Good
Tumblr media
check the injector pulse and wiring Good
Taking a step back I carefully though about the situation and decided to simplify the troubleshooting and stick with the facts. I knew that there was no issue with any component and retesting anything would be a complete waste of time. I went through every system that ends in a cranks but does not start situation…… and they were fine…… But there was another answer, One that I didn’t even try to check because I was still thinking about the owner of the vehicle telling me about how it ran and then just died! It died and never started again! I was too involved in thinking there was a failure because it died! So If we start with only the facts and ignore all the random codes and tomfoolery we have 3 facts.
I left the EGR line off and it ran for 1min or so.
Tumblr media
The plugs were covered in carbon, Indicative of fouling
All systems are working fine and vacuum is odd when measured
Conclusion….. Occam’s Razor!
I already knew what was happening and didn’t even bother to test anything else……
I Immediately pulled off the Exhaust and the answer to the simple question was right in front of me the whole time!
The catalytic converters were clogged about 90%
